COPASI API
4.40.278
|
This is the complete list of members for CStepMatrix, including all inherited members.
add(CStepMatrixColumn *pColumn) | CStepMatrix | inline |
addColumn(const CZeroSet &set, const CStepMatrixColumn *pPositive, const CStepMatrixColumn *pNegative) | CStepMatrix | |
applyPivot(const CVectorCore< size_t > &pivot) | CVectorCore< CType > | inlineprivate |
array() | CVectorCore< CType > | inlineprivate |
array() const | CVectorCore< CType > | inlineprivate |
begin() const | CStepMatrix | |
CVector< CStepMatrixColumn * >::begin() | CVectorCore< CType > | inlineprivate |
compact() | CStepMatrix | |
const_iterator typedef | CStepMatrix | |
convertRow() | CStepMatrix | |
convertRow(const size_t &index, CMatrix< C_INT64 > &nullspaceMatrix) | CStepMatrix | private |
copy(const CVectorCore< CStepMatrixColumn * > &rhs) | CVector< CStepMatrixColumn * > | inlineprivate |
CStepMatrix() | CStepMatrix | private |
CStepMatrix(size_t rows) | CStepMatrix | |
CStepMatrix(CMatrix< C_INT64 > &nullspaceMatrix) | CStepMatrix | |
CVector(size_t size=0) | CVector< CStepMatrixColumn * > | inlineprivate |
CVector(const CVectorCore< CStepMatrixColumn * > &src) | CVector< CStepMatrixColumn * > | inlineprivate |
CVector(const CVector< CStepMatrixColumn * > &src) | CVector< CStepMatrixColumn * > | inlineprivate |
CVectorCore(const size_t &size=0, CType *buffer=NULL) | CVectorCore< CType > | inlineprivate |
CVectorCore(const CVectorCore< CType > &src) | CVectorCore< CType > | inlineprivate |
elementType typedef | CVectorCore< CType > | private |
end() const | CStepMatrix | |
CVector< CStepMatrixColumn * >::end() | CVectorCore< CType > | inlineprivate |
getAllUnsetBitIndexes(const CStepMatrixColumn *pColumn, CVector< size_t > &indexes) const | CStepMatrix | |
getFirstUnconvertedRow() const | CStepMatrix | |
getNumUnconvertedRows() const | CStepMatrix | |
getUnsetBitIndexes(const CStepMatrixColumn *pColumn, CVector< size_t > &indexes) const | CStepMatrix | |
initialize(const size_t &size, const CType *vector) | CVectorCore< CType > | inlineprivate |
initialize(const CVectorCore< CType > &src) | CVectorCore< CType > | inlineprivate |
iterator typedef | CStepMatrix | private |
mBeyond | CStepMatrix | private |
mFirstUnconvertedRow | CStepMatrix | private |
mInsert | CStepMatrix | private |
mpBuffer | CVectorCore< CType > | private |
mPivot | CStepMatrix | private |
mRows | CStepMatrix | private |
mSize | CVectorCore< CType > | private |
operator()(const size_t &row) | CVectorCore< CType > | inlineprivate |
operator()(const size_t &row) const | CVectorCore< CType > | inlineprivate |
operator<<(std::ostream &, const CStepMatrix &) | CStepMatrix | friend |
operator=(const CVectorCore< CStepMatrixColumn * > &rhs) | CVector< CStepMatrixColumn * > | inlineprivate |
operator=(const CVector< CStepMatrixColumn * > &rhs) | CVector< CStepMatrixColumn * > | inlineprivate |
operator=(const CStepMatrixColumn * &value) | CVector< CStepMatrixColumn * > | inlineprivate |
CVectorCore::operator=(const CVectorCore< CType > &rhs) | CVectorCore< CType > | inlineprivate |
CVectorCore::operator=(const CType &value) | CVectorCore< CType > | inlineprivate |
operator==(const CVectorCore< CType > &rhs) const | CVectorCore< CType > | inlineprivate |
operator[](const size_t &row) | CVectorCore< CType > | inlineprivate |
operator[](const size_t &row) const | CVectorCore< CType > | inlineprivate |
removeColumn(CStepMatrixColumn *pColumn) | CStepMatrix | |
removeInvalidColumns(std::vector< CStepMatrixColumn * > &invalidColumns) | CStepMatrix | |
resize(size_t size, const bool ©=false) | CVector< CStepMatrixColumn * > | inlineprivate |
size() const | CVectorCore< CType > | inlineprivate |
splitColumns(std::vector< CStepMatrixColumn * > &PositiveColumns, std::vector< CStepMatrixColumn * > &NegativeColumns, std::vector< CStepMatrixColumn * > &NullColumns) | CStepMatrix | |
~CStepMatrix() | CStepMatrix | |
~CVector() | CVector< CStepMatrixColumn * > | inlineprivatevirtual |
~CVectorCore() | CVectorCore< CType > | inlineprivatevirtual |